Yoruba must vote for Tinubu – Osun APC chairman

Michael Ofulue ,Osogbo

The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Osun State, Prince Gboyega Famodun has said that only a bastard son of Yoruba will fail to support Bola Tinubu’s ambition to succeed President Muhammadu Buhari in 2023.

This is just as the Chairman said that the former Governor of Lagos State and National Leader of the ruling APC,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u, has all it takes to succeed President Buhari.

Famodun stated this while addressing thousands of supporters and members of APC who converged on the popular Freedom Park, Osogbo after staging a street walk in solidarity with Tinubu/Shetima presidential ambition.

Members of the party led by the Governor, Gboyega Oyetola, had walked through Oke-Fia down to Alekuwodo, Ola-iya junction, Odiolowo, Isale- Osun, station road, Lautech Ajegunle road and terminated it at Freedom Park, Osogbo.

Addressing the mammoth crowd, Famodun condemned how the Yorubas were at the forefront of pull-him-down-syndrome that never made the late Awolowo and others realise their ambition.

He described Tinubu as a visionary leader and great achiever, just as he berated the lackadaisical attitude of some Yorubas, urging the sons and daughters of Yorubaland to always rally round their leaders.

Speaking, Governor  Oyetola who was physically elated by the impressive number of  people at the venue said Tinubu is most qualified to rule the country.

He said: “The walk for Tinubu is a very fortunate one because we will love to testify to its goodness. Tinubu will become the president of this nation because God’s mouth has proclaimed it.
